CINE 422 Camera Movement: Practical Application of the Moving Camera


This advanced course is designed for cinematography students who are about to embark on a capstone experience. The class covers the study and practical application of camera movement. Students will complete multiple exercises in designing, blocking, lighting and shooting that contain choreographed camera movement. Additionally, students rotate through the four distinct jobs required for successful shot making: director of photography, camera operator, first camera assistant, and dolly grip.
